After a successful run in October 2017, Wood Pro Expo will return to Lancaster October 18-19, 2018 at a new larger venue, the Warehouse at the Nook.  Wood Pro Expo is a regional show for woodworking businesses bringing suppliers and experts together for a localized presentation of equipment and supply solutions. In each city where it takes place, it includes a strong educational program on best practices for shop production, and as well as an expo oriented to equipment and supplies geared to small and medium-size shops, including CNC basics, employee recruitment, finishing, lean manufacturing, business management, software, and shop safety.

Masonite sells architectural business segment

TAMPA, Fla. — Masonite International Corp. announced that it has entered into a definitive agreement for the sale of all assets associated with the company’s Architectural segment to subsidiaries of IBP Solutions, Inc., a newly formed portfolio company of Industrial Opportunity Partners.The transaction is expected to close in the second quarter of 2024 and is subject to customary closing conditions.Houlihan Lokey, Inc. acted as Masonite’s financial advisor on the transaction.

1847 executes Letter of Intent to sell 1847 Cabinets Inc. for $27.6 million

NEW YORK — 1847 Holdings LLC, a holding company, announced the execution of a non-binding Letter of Intent with a prospective strategic buyer to sell all assets of 1847 Cabinets Inc.Under the terms of the LOI, the buyer has proposed an enterprise value of $27.6 million for the acquisition of all assets of 1847 Cabinets Inc. The amount, the company said in a statement, represents a 5.91x multiple of 2023 EBITDA of approximately $4.7 million.
